Australian researchers are putting a new way to detect early changes in cognitive health to the test.


Researchers at Flinders University have developed a new tool to detect early changes in cognitive health. 

Dubbed the Spatial Navigation and Memory (SPAM) Questionnaire – no relation to the pre-cooked canned meat product, mind you – the tool is marketed as a more accessible, time-efficient clinical test that is sensitive to cognitive ageing.  

The development and validation of the SPAM was described in Alzheimer’s & Dementia: Diagnosis, Assessment & Disease Monitoring. Nine hundred and seventy healthy older adults (aged ≥65 years) completed the SPAM electronically, where they were asked questions about recent (18 items, relating to the last three months) and lifetime (12 items) spatial navigation and memory abilities. 

The spatial navigation questions covered topics such as general navigation behaviour, egocentric and allocentric navigation strategy use, spatial memory, and disorientation, while the memory items focused on the recall of events, names, and faces, learning new information, and attentional memory problems.  

“Difficulty navigating unfamiliar environments and subtle disorientation are common in Alzheimer’s disease, and often precedes noticeable memory loss and later significant navigational deficits,” said cognitive neuroscientist and lead author Dr Monique Boord (PhD).  

Exploratory and confirmatory factor analysis supported the SPAM as an appropriate assessment of spatial navigation and memory abilities in this particular cohort. In addition, spatial navigation scores on the SPAM were correlated with performance on a virtual shopping task (an objective measure of spatial navigation performance that can discriminate between Alzheimer’s disease and non-Alzheimer’s disease dementias). 

“Greater difficulties with recent spatial navigation on the SPAM were associated with greater egocentric and allocentric navigation errors on the VST,” the researchers wrote.  

Dr Stephanie Wong (PhD), a senior lecturer in the College of Human Sciences and Culture at Flinders University and senior author on the new research, echoed Dr Boord’s comments. 

“People in the early stages of dementia often face a hidden challenge. They begin to struggle with directions and get lost, even in familiar places,” she said in a statement. “While patients notice these changes, clinicians haven’t had a step-by-step checklist to ask about them.” 

“Relying on personal memory is too subjective. By introducing a structured way to track these spatial navigational difficulties, our research team can help clinicians remove the guesswork, spot cognitive decline much sooner, and help families plan their loved ones’ safety.”  

These findings are related to the Spatial Navigation Assessment Validation and Implementation (SNAVI) study, which is currently recruiting participants in Adelaide. Individuals with mild cognitive impairment or Alzheimer’s disease may be eligible to participate.
